People who are vaccinated will be allowed into Times Square with proof of vaccination.

Revellers will be allowed to attend this year's New Year's Eve celebrations in New York's Times Square, the city's mayor has confirmed.People wanting to see the ball drop this year will have to show proof of full vaccination or a negative Covid test if exempt.

"We can finally get back together again. It's going to be amazing, it's going to be a joy for this city," Mayor Bill de Blasio said.
